In this compelling volume, the story takes readers deeper into the mystical realm of Excalibur, where heroes and legends collide. Under the masterful storytelling of Chris Claremont, the narrative unfolds with vibrant illustrations by Alan Davis and a talented ensemble of artists, ensuring a visual feast that complements the gripping plot. Claremont draws upon the rich tapestry of the Marvel Universe, intertwining themes of honor, sacrifice, and the quest for identity.

The characters grapple with not just external foes but also their internal struggles, adding layers of complexity to their heroic endeavors. As the team faces new challenges, they discover the true meaning of teamwork and the strength that lies in their diverse backgrounds. The stakes are raised as alliances are tested and new threats emerge from both familiar adversaries and unexpected sources.

Amidst battles and intrigue, readers are treated to moments of profound camaraderie and tension, spotlighting the bonds that unite the heroes. Claremont's keen understanding of character development shines through, making each individual in the ensemble feel relatable and real.

As the narrative unfolds, the exploration of loyalty and friendship becomes more than just plot devices; they are the heart of the story. The imaginative art style enhances the storytelling, creating a vivid canvas where each panel pulsates with emotion and action. This edition not only serves as a continuation of a beloved saga but also reaffirms the enduring legacy of Excalibur within the Marvel mythos.
